The Decision
Comparing the two cars, you can see the difference in quality. The EBS Convertible is good - very good, but the Peugeot's finish is better. For instance, The Five's doors shut with a clang, the rear windows are difficult to close (they don't want to line up with the seals) and the rubber seals around the windows need improving. Admittedly, the latter problems can be rectified by EBS.

Structurally, the Five does conquer scuttle shake better than the 205 (though it is not a real problem on either car) despite lacking a roll-bar.

In the end though, the decision rests with the styling. If you prefer the Five's shape, you'll go for the conversion, though they are very rare (only 33 in the country!) and they will cost money. If you want a cheaper, more conventional car, you'll go for the 205 CJ - they are easier to find!!

For most people, the CJ is the best option. But, as a Five owner, I'll go for the Conversion!!
